Role Specific Responsibilities:

  • Scrum Facilitation: Guide and coach data and analytics teams in Scrum practices, facilitating all ceremonies (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Planning, Reviews, Retrospectives).

  • SAFe Coordination: Support Agile Release Train (ART) events and processes, ensuring alignment of data and reporting projects with enterprise objectives.

  • Project Management: Plan, coordinate, and oversee data and reporting project deliverables, timelines, and resources, ensuring alignment with business goals and compliance standards.

  • Stakeholder Management: Collaborate with data engineers, data analysts, business intelligence developers, product owners, and business stakeholders to define requirements, manage expectations, and communicate project status.

  • Impediment Removal: Proactively identify and resolve obstacles that may hinder team progress, particularly those related to data quality, integration, or reporting challenges.

  • Continuous Improvement: Foster a culture of continuous improvement, encouraging team learning, process enhancements, and adoption of best practices in data management and reporting.

  • Metrics & Reporting: Track and report key Agile metrics (velocity, burndown, etc.) and provide visibility into data project progress, risks, and outcomes.

  • Risk Management: Identify, assess, and mitigate risks and dependencies, especially those impacting data integrity, security, or regulatory compliance.

  • Cross-Team Collaboration: Work with other Scrum Masters, Release Train Engineers, and teams to ensure consistent delivery and integration of data solutions across the organization.

  • Agile Coaching: Mentor team members and stakeholders on Agile, SAFe, and data project best practices.

Requirements

Required Skills:

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business, or a related field.

  • 5+ years of experience as a Scrum Master, Agile Coach, or Project Manager, with a focus on data, analytics, or reporting projects.

  • Hands-on experience working in a SAFe environment (SAFe certification preferred, e.g., SAFe Scrum Master (SSM), SAFe Agilist (SA)).

  • Experience using Agile project management tools (e.g., Jira, Azure DevOps, Rally).

  • Proven experience managing data management, data warehouse, business intelligence, or reporting projects using Agile and traditional project management methodologies.

  • Strong understanding of Agile principles, Scrum, Kanban, and SAFe practices.

  • Familiarity with data management concepts, ETL processes, data modelling, and reporting t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au).

  • Excellent facilitation, conflict resolution, and servant leadership skills.

  • Strong organisational, analytical, and problem-solving abilities.

  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ills.

Preferred Skills:

  • Project Management certification (e.g., PMP, PRINCE2).

  • Experience working with data governance, data privacy, and compliance requirements.

  • Experience with cloud data platforms (e.g., Azure, AWS, GCP).

  • Experience leading Agile transformation or change management initiatives.
